The Jewish Genealogy Society of Long Island invites you to join us at
our Sunday, March 17, meeting. Topic: "Holocaust Research and Records" Guest Speakers: Peter Lande and Bill Farran Peter Lande is a volunteer at the U.S. Holocaust Memorial Museum. He has traveled throughout Europe to locate and acquire lists of Holocaust victims and survivors. He has computerized thousands of names for inclusion in Museum and Jewishgen databases. In 2001 he received the IAJGS Lifetime Achievement Award for his work to identify resources and create finding aids for Holocaust research. JGSLI member, Bill Farran, will exhibit and give a short presentation about his wood etchings of "Lost Synagogues".
